California joins push to let cannabis businesses use banks as part of coronavirus relief
The Orange County Register:
California Attorney General Xavier Becerra is joining a bipartisan group of 34 attorneys general in urging Congress to approve a coronavirus relief package that would let marijuana businesses use traditional banking services. The Democrat-controlled House on Friday, May 15, approved the idea of granting banking access to cannabis businesses as part of the $3 trillion HEROES Act, which would provide the
biggest package of programs yet aimed at buffering the economic fallout of the coronavirus pandemic
